OK, tested it. Not exactly to my liking though. The layout is crude. Not as refined as Garmin Mobile XT. Maps are also not as detailed as MFM and MSM maps.
Looks like its more suitable for Singapore maps.
GPS lock on is about the same as Garmin's.
However, I need to set the GPS baud rate to 9600 for NavFone and 57600 for Garmin. As for me, I'll stick to my trusty ol' Garmin. smile.gif

QUOTE(CrisisX @ Sep 21 2009, 11:34 AM)
talking bout s2u2, i tried once and need to unlock from the ori lock screen, then only unlock again with s2u2, which i feel kinda pointless

or izit some settings tat can allow s2u2 to totally replace the ori lock screen?
*
you can turn off the stock lock screen by going to Samsung's 'Setting'->'Display & Light'->'Lock Screen' and untick 'Lock when device is woken up'
